Outline of Final Research Achievements |
This study focused on several aspects of humanlikeness in game playing. It results in new concepts such as game information dynamics model and game-refinement model, by which we cultivated a new paradigm of game informatics research. We proposed two different kinds of novel information dynamic models based on fluid mechanics. These models are a series of approximate solutions for the flow past a flat plate at zero incidence. It is suggested that the present models make it possible to discuss the information dynamics in games and practical problems such as projects starting from zero information and ending with full information. We presented a mathematical model of game progress and game refinement. The second derivative value is derived from the model and we proposed to use the value as a measure of game refinement. We support the effectiveness of the proposed theory while showing some data from well-known games.
